Determine your design style.
Look through home decorating
magazines and see what you like.
You may have thought that you
were inspired by country living,
but find yourself drawn to the
clean lines of a modern design.
Even if you like both styles,
you can mix them to create a
style that is your own. You can
choose country items that have a
more modern edge, and modern
design pieces with country
flair.
This way you can achieve a look
that you love without settling
on one style. |

Wall
Colours
One living room decorating idea
that is sure to spice up your
space is to choose a bold wall
colour.
Some
shy away from saturated colours,
but these are the very hues that
can make a dramatic statement
about your personality. If you
do not want to paint all of the
walls in your living room a bold
colour, you can paint an accent
wall.
These walls are great to make
an impression without
overwhelming the room. You can
then use accessories to tie the
colour into the rest of the room

Window Treatments
Updating your window treatments
will also go a long way towards
improving the atmosphere. Choose
binds or curtains that
compliment the design style you
have chosen for the rest of your
room.
Using rich looking fabrics on
the windows will add a feeling
of luxury to your room, and help
to bring all of your living room
decorating ideas together.

Lighting - is yours right?
Another key element in living
room decorating ideas is
lighting.
Make
sure your lighting is adequate,
but not overpowering. Dont use
florescent lights as they are
very harsh, and a living room is
all about mood.
Use an updated overhead fixture
to provide general light, and a
few lamps around the room for
task lighting.
Don't overlook candles. Not only
are they decorative, but they
provide mood lighting as well.
You can get candles and holders
in all different colours and
sizes to help achieve your
living room decorating ideas. |

Wall Art
On thing not to neglect is
putting art on your walls.
This helps to bring the room
together and adds a personal
touch. You can choose painted
canvases that can look great all
on their own, or a framed print
in shades that compliment your
colour scheme.
Another
great wall art idea is
photographs. These can be family
pictures or perhaps a black and
white landscape or city sky
line. The key here is not to
overdo it. Keep it simple and
un-crowded. If your walls are
too busy, it will detract from
the overall atmosphere you are
working to create |
